Best Durable, Minimalist Smartwatches at a Glance
| Model | Best for | Case and size | Published weight | Protection profile |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| KOSPET MAGIC R10 | Refined daily wear in a traditional watch shape | Round; 46 × 46 × 12 mm | 67.2 g including strap | Stainless-steel body, scratch-resistant display, 5 ATM water resistance |
| KOSPET MAGIC P10 | Modern daily wear with a structured display | Square; 47.7 × 40.8 × 12.3 mm | 70 g including strap | Stainless-steel body, scratch-resistant display, 5 ATM water resistance |
| KOSPET ORB 2 | Work, hiking, camping, and outdoor use in a round design | Round; 48 × 48 × 12.7 mm | 41 g without strap | SGS testing against 12 MIL-STD-810H methods, full-metal bezel, Gorilla Glass, 5 ATM and IP69 |
| KOSPET PULSE 2 | Outdoor protection with a larger square display | Square; 50 × 44.3 × 12.4 mm | 40.5 g without strap | SGS testing against 12 MIL-STD-810H methods, full-metal bezel, Gorilla Glass, 5 ATM and IP69 |
Published weights use different measurement methods. MAGIC weights include the strap, while ORB 2 and PULSE 2 weights exclude it, so they should not be compared directly as complete on-wrist weights.
What Makes a Durable Smartwatch Look Minimalist?
A durable smartwatch looks minimalist when its protective elements are integrated into the watch rather than added as visual decoration. The goal is not necessarily to create the smallest possible watch, but to avoid unnecessary bulk and an overly tactical appearance.
The four models achieve this through several design choices:
- Integrated protection: The case, bezel, glass, and enclosure perform the protective work without relying on oversized guards or decorative armor.
- Simpler surfaces: Clean metal finishes and restrained case detailing create a more polished appearance than exposed screws and heavily segmented bezels.
- Familiar silhouettes: Round models resemble conventional wristwatches, while square models use straight edges to create a clean digital layout.
- Adaptable styling: A restrained watch face and a leather, magnetic, or woven strap can make the watch easier to pair with office clothing, casual outfits, or sportswear.
MAGIC R10 and MAGIC P10 place greater emphasis on polished stainless-steel surfaces and everyday versatility. ORB 2 and PULSE 2 look more technical, but their rugged features remain primarily structural. They are not ultra-thin dress watches; they are cleaner-looking alternatives for users who still need practical outdoor protection.
Choose by Protection Level
The right protection level depends on the conditions the watch will regularly face. Everyday commuting and exercise do not require the same published durability evidence as physical work, dusty environments, or frequent outdoor activity.
MAGIC R10 and MAGIC P10: Polished Everyday Durability
Choose the MAGIC pair when the watch needs to move easily between work, exercise, and casual daily wear.
- Suitable conditions: Commuting, daily workouts, sweat, rain, pool swimming, and light outdoor activity.
- Main advantage: The polished metal construction provides practical protection without making the watch look overtly rugged.
- Design choice: Select MAGIC R10 for a traditional round profile or MAGIC P10 for a more contemporary square interface.
- Important limitation: KOSPET does not present the MAGIC pair with the same SGS-tested, 12-method MIL-STD-810H claim published for ORB 2 and PULSE 2.
The absence of equivalent environmental testing does not prove that MAGIC R10 or MAGIC P10 is fragile. It means buyers who regularly face impacts, vibration, dust, or changing outdoor conditions have less published evidence on which to base their decision.
ORB 2 and PULSE 2: More Extensively Documented Rugged Protection
Choose ORB 2 or PULSE 2 when environmental protection carries more weight in the buying decision.

- Suitable conditions: Active work, outdoor training, hiking, camping, dusty environments, rain, and shallow-water activity.
- Main advantage: Their durability case is supported by several forms of published evidence, including SGS environmental testing, reinforced display protection, and water and dust ratings.
- Shared rugged foundation: ORB 2 and PULSE 2 carry the same principal protection claims. PULSE 2 should not be treated as a less durable fitness version of ORB 2.
- Practical difference: ORB 2 uses a 1.43-inch round AMOLED display and a 500 mAh battery rated for up to 16 days of typical use. PULSE 2 uses a larger 1.96-inch square AMOLED display and a 450 mAh battery rated for up to 15 days.
These specifications provide a clearer basis for choosing ORB 2 or PULSE 2 for more demanding environments, but they do not make either watch indestructible. Scratch resistance should not be interpreted as scratch-proof protection.
Round or Square: Which Design Should You Choose?
Case shape does not determine durability. Once the required protection level has been selected, choose the shape according to visual preference, wrist fit, and how information should appear on the screen.
| Preference | Round: MAGIC R10 or ORB 2 | Square: MAGIC P10 or PULSE 2 |
|---|---|---|
| Visual style | More similar to a conventional wristwatch | Cleaner, more digital appearance |
| Best screen use | Traditional watch faces and compact layouts | Messages, menus, charts, and multiple workout metrics |
| More compact option | MAGIC R10 is smaller than ORB 2 | MAGIC P10 is smaller than PULSE 2 |
| Better suited to | Users who prioritize familiar watch styling | Users who prioritize screen space and readability |
A round case is not automatically more impact-resistant, and a square display is not inherently less durable. Materials, water-resistance ratings, ingress protection, and environmental test evidence matter more than shape.
FAQs
Can I Swim with These Smartwatches?
All four models carry a 5 ATM water-resistance rating, and KOSPET lists pool swimming or shallow-water activity among their intended uses. ORB 2 and PULSE 2 additionally carry IP69 ingress-protection ratings.
These ratings do not mean unlimited waterproofing. Users should follow the applicable product instructions and should not treat the watches as diving equipment.
Does MIL-STD-810H Mean the Watch Is Military Certified?
No. MIL-STD-810H is a U.S. Department of Defense standard containing environmental test methods. Testing a smartwatch against selected methods within the standard is not the same as receiving a universal military certification.
KOSPET states that ORB 2 and PULSE 2 were tested by SGS against 12 methods within MIL-STD-810H. This provides documented evidence related to specific environmental conditions, but it does not guarantee protection against every form of impact, water exposure, temperature change, or accidental damage. The complete standard is available through the U.S. Defense Logistics Agency.
